Uzbekistan Tourism Highlights
Things to Do in Uzbekistan
- Visit Samarkand’s Registan Square: Known as one of the most beautiful squares in the world, Registan Square in Samarkand is a masterpiece of Islamic architecture and a UNESCO World Heritage site.
- Explore Bukhara’s Historical Sites: Bukhara, with its ancient buildings, narrow streets, and vibrant bazaars, is a must-visit for history enthusiasts. Don't miss the Ark Fortress and the Bolo Haouz Mosque.
- Discover Khiva's Ancient Walls: Step back in time in Khiva, a city where the ancient Itchan Kala stands as a testament to the city’s historic significance along the Silk Road.
- Relax in the Fergana Valley: Known for its picturesque landscapes and traditional handicrafts, the Fergana Valley offers a peaceful getaway from the hustle and bustle of the cities.
- Visit Tashkent’s Modern Landmarks: Uzbekistan’s capital, Tashkent, blends history with modernity. Explore the Khast Imam Complex and Amir Timur Square for a taste of Uzbekistan's rich heritage and contemporary culture.
- Take a Tour of the Silk Road: Uzbekistan is a key stop on the ancient Silk Road, and you can explore key historical sites like Samarkand, Bukhara, and Khiva, which were once thriving centers of trade and culture.
Top Places to Visit in Uzbekistan
- Samarkand: Home to the stunning Registan Square, Shah-i-Zinda, and the Gur-e-Amir Mausoleum, Samarkand is a must-visit for anyone interested in history and architecture.
- Bukhara: A city filled with ancient madrasas, mosques, and fortresses, Bukhara offers an unforgettable journey into Uzbekistan’s rich past.
- Khiva: A UNESCO-listed city surrounded by ancient walls, Khiva is a true representation of Uzbekistan's glorious past.
- Tashkent: The capital city combines modern amenities with rich cultural heritage. Visit the Khast Imam Complex, Independence Square, and the Tashkent TV Tower.
- Fergana Valley: Known for its natural beauty and craftsmanship, the Fergana Valley is ideal for exploring Uzbek traditions, handicrafts, and peaceful landscapes.

Indian Restaurants & Food in Uzbekistan
Uzbek cuisine is rich, flavorful, and diverse, heavily influenced by Central Asian and Middle Eastern cultures. Indian travelers will find familiar tastes in the vibrant markets and restaurants across Uzbekistan’s major cities. In Tashkent, Samarkand, and Bukhara, there are several Indian restaurants offering classic favorites like butter chicken, naan, biryani, and chicken tikka.
But don’t miss out on trying Uzbekistan’s traditional dishes, such as plov (rice pilaf), shashlik (grilled meat skewers), manti (dumplings), and lagman (noodle soup). The combination of spices and flavors will leave you craving for more.
Shopping Spots in Uzbekistan
- Chorsu Bazaar (Tashkent): This bustling market offers everything from spices and dried fruits to handicrafts and textiles. It's a perfect place for unique souvenirs.
- Bukhara’s Trading Domes: Bukhara’s ancient trading domes house traditional markets where you can shop for carpets, silk, and pottery.
- Samarkand Silk Road Market: This historical market offers traditional Silk Road goods such as antique items, jewelry, and embroidered fabrics.
- Fergana Valley: Known for its traditional ceramics and handmade fabrics, the Fergana Valley is ideal for purchasing authentic Uzbek handicrafts.
